Though maybe that’s the piffling side-concern of a woman who isn’t having to choose between heating and eating, who hasn’t been told by MP Rachel Maclean she just needs to get a better job to shore up future finances, or that, should she be forced to shoplift to feed her family, new police recommendations propose leniency in prosecutions, so fine.
I heard a report into the cost of living crisis on the radio recently in which the reporter referred to spiralling numbers of people ‘admitting’ to. This was a compassionate item on the pity of new poverty, yet the use of ‘admitting’ felt gross: like debt is a crime, as opposed to an inevitability for people who once chugged along OK, but are now so suddenly and horribly reduced – by factors far beyond their control – they’re staring food banks square in the eye.
